Activating Compound | Comment | Organism | Structure |
---|---|---|---|
additional information | agonist activation of peroxisome proliferator-activated receptors alpha and delta specifically upregulates PDK4 transcription, while activation of peroxisome proliferator-activated receptor gamma specifically downregulates PDK2 transcription, reduced glucose levels increase expression levels of PDK2 and PDK4, the stimulation effect is reversed by insulin, insulin alone decreases the enzyme expression levels below basal values | Homo sapiens | |
oleate | activates PDK2 and PDK4 nearly 2fold at 0.1 mM, not synergistic with palmitate, stimulation is completely inhibited by insulin at 0.001 mM | Homo sapiens | |
palmitate | activates PDK2 and PDK4 nearly 2fold at 0.1 mM, not synergistic with oleate, stimulation is completely inhibited by insulin at 0.001 mmM | Homo sapiens |

Inhibitors | Comment | Organism | Structure |
---|---|---|---|
additional information | insulin reverses the stimulation effect of reduced glucose levels increasing expression levels of PDK2 and PDK4, insulin alone decreases the enzyme expression levels below basal values, insulin effects on the enzyme are inhibited by phosphoatidyl 3-kinase inhibitors wortmannin and LY294002, i.e. 2-(4-morpholinyl)-8-phenyl-4H-1-benzopyran-4-one | Homo sapiens | |
Rapamycin | inhibits PDK2 and PDK4, has no effect on insulin-caused downregulation of the isozymes | Homo sapiens |
